What Vacant Land Contract (VAC-14)?

A vacant land contract, also known as VAC-14, is a legal document that outlines the terms and conditions of the sale or purchase of vacant land. Includes such purchase price, schedule, any contingencies need before transaction finalized. This contract is crucial for protecting the rights and interests of both the buyer and the seller, and it plays a vital role in the smooth transfer of ownership.

Vacant Land Contract (VAC-14)

This vacant land contract (VAC-14) is entered into on this [Date] by and between [Seller Name], hereinafter referred to as the “Seller,” and [Buyer Name], hereinafter referred to as the “Buyer.” This contract is governed by the laws of the state of [State].

1. Preamble
This contract is made for the sale of a vacant land located at [Address], including all fixtures and improvements thereon, by the Seller to the Buyer.
2. Purchase Price Payment Terms
The purchase price for the vacant land shall be [Purchase Price] to be paid in full by the Buyer to the Seller on or before the closing date of this contract. Payment shall be made in [Payment Method].
3. Closing Date
The closing date for this contract shall be on or before [Closing Date], unless extended by mutual agreement of the parties in writing.
4. Title Inspection
The Seller shall provide the Buyer with a marketable title to the vacant land, free and clear of all liens and encumbrances. The Buyer shall have the right to conduct inspections and due diligence on the vacant land prior to the closing date.
5. Default Remedies
In the event of default by either party, the non-defaulting party shall have the right to pursue legal remedies available under the law, including specific performance and damages.

Top 10 Legal Questions about Vacant Land Contract (VAC-14)

Question Answer
1.What is a Vacant Land Contract (VAC-14)? A Vacant Land Contract (VAC-14) is a legally binding agreement between a buyer and a seller for the sale of vacant land. It outlines the terms and conditions of the sale, including the purchase price, payment schedule, and any contingencies.
2. What are the key elements of a Vacant Land Contract (VAC-14)? The key elements of a Vacant Land Contract (VAC-14) include the legal description of the property, purchase price, down payment amount, closing date, and any contingencies such as financing or land survey.
3. Can a Vacant Land Contract (VAC-14) be customized to suit specific needs? Absolutely! A Vacant Land Contract (VAC-14) can be customized to accommodate the unique requirements of both the buyer and seller. This include provisions land use, restrictions, or considerations.
4. What happens if either party breaches the Vacant Land Contract (VAC-14)? If either the buyer or seller breaches the Vacant Land Contract (VAC-14), the non-breaching party may be entitled to remedies such as specific performance, monetary damages, or even cancellation of the contract.
5. Is it necessary to hire a lawyer to review a Vacant Land Contract (VAC-14)? While it is not mandatory, it is highly recommended to seek legal counsel to review a Vacant Land Contract (VAC-14) to ensure that all terms are fair and legally binding. A lawyer can also help identify any potential risks or liabilities.
6. Can a Vacant Land Contract (VAC-14) include contingencies? Yes, a Vacant Land Contract (VAC-14) can include contingencies such as financing, land survey, or approval of land use permits. These provide protection both buyer seller event certain conditions not met.
7. What is the role of a title search in a Vacant Land Contract (VAC-14)? A title search is crucial in a Vacant Land Contract (VAC-14) as it uncovers any existing liens, easements, or encumbrances on the property. This helps ensure that the seller has clear and marketable title to the land being sold.
8. Can a Vacant Land Contract (VAC-14) be assigned to another party? Yes, a Vacant Land Contract (VAC-14) can typically be assigned to another party with the consent of both the buyer and seller. However, it is important to review the contract for any specific provisions relating to assignment.
9. Are there any special considerations for purchasing vacant land through a Vacant Land Contract (VAC-14)? When purchasing vacant land through a Vacant Land Contract (VAC-14), it is important to consider factors such as zoning laws, access to utilities, environmental regulations, and potential future development in the area.
10. What are the tax implications of buying and selling vacant land under a Vacant Land Contract (VAC-14)? The tax implications of buying and selling vacant land under a Vacant Land Contract (VAC-14) can vary depending on factors such as holding period, use of the land, and any potential capital gains. It is advisable to consult with a tax advisor for personalized guidance.
